Wi-Fi, short for Wireless Fidelity, refers to a technology that allows electronic devices to connect to a wireless local area network (WLAN) using radio waves. It enables devices such as computers, smartphones, and tablets to communicate with each other and access the internet without the need for physical wired connections. Wi-Fi operates on various frequency bands, typically in the 2.4 GHz and 5 GHz ranges. It is widely used in homes, businesses, and public spaces, providing convenience and mobility for users to connect to a network and share information seamlessly.
